The ISEE (Independent School Entrance Exam) is a standardized test used by independent and private schools to evaluate student readiness for admission. Students in Cincinnati take the ISEE when applying to selective independent schools in the area, as it helps admissions committees assess academic skills in verbal reasoning, quantitative reasoning, reading comprehension, and math achievement across grade levels.
The ISEE has four levels: Primary (grades 2-3), Lower (grades 4-5), Middle (grades 6-7), and Upper (grades 8-11). The level you take depends on your current grade and the schools you're applying to—most schools specify which level is required for their admission process. Many students struggle with the verbal reasoning section, which requires understanding complex vocabulary and making logical connections without a defined curriculum to study. The quantitative reasoning section also challenges students because it tests problem-solving and logic rather than just computational skills. Time management is another major obstacle—the ISEE is fast-paced, and students need practice working through questions efficiently while maintaining accuracy.

Most students benefit from 2-3 months of consistent preparation, though the ideal timeline depends on your current skill level and target schools. Students starting from a stronger academic foundation may need less time, while those working on vocabulary or math fundamentals may benefit from 4-6 months of tutoring.
